FE02 BXJ is a 2002 Maserati Coupe in Red with a 4,244c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 3 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 100%.
Across all 2002 Maserati Coupe models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.8% with a typical mileage of 44,614 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Maserati Coupe fails its MOT is steering rack gaiter split, accounting for 514 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FE02 BXJ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Maserati Coupe typ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 24 years old, this Maserati Coupe is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
